Podcast #32 is up!
Podcast #32
RSS Feed
ITunes Music Store Link
Welcome back again! We can't help ourselves, we have to start complaining (did we ever stop?) about the fast rising gas prices again.
The Camaro Concept has made it's way to the New York Auto show now. It is still receiving rave reviews from the media. Try and get down there if you can to see it in person.
The new Classifieds section is now live. Check it out at http://www.camaroz28.com/classifieds. The old threads from the For Sale section are still there, but they are set as Read Only. They will go away on May 1, 2006. If you have an questions on the new Classifieds section, please check out the Site Help and Suggestions part of the Message Board. We'll be happy to answer and questions you may have.
Thread of the Week:
In the N2O forum on the Message Board, there is a thread called Spark Plug Reference Chart. Excellent source of information on what type of plug to run with Nitrous.
